 Denmark's oldest town is situated only 30 km from Esbjerg. It has small cobblestone streets and beautiful half-timbered houses. In Ribe you find Denmark's only cathedral with five aisles, and it is possible to visit the tower of the 800 year old cathedral and enjoy a view over marschland and the tidal area.  The Museum Ribe's Vikings you can experience the Viking era and the Middle Age, normally buried beneath the streets in Ribe. The museum displays thousands of artifacts found during recent archaeological excavations in Ribe.
